  1. Summertime is looked forward to by everybody for various reasons especially for playing games. Children look forward to it with great joy. When school hours are over they gather together and play games of every kind.
    The most common games played by children in the open air are Cook, Hide-and-Seek, Fox-and-chickens, Tugawar, Corners, and Wallflowers.
    To play "Cook" two children must make a ring with stones and this is called the "Cook". One must remain
    inside this ring and the other must follow the other children, and catch them before they get inside the ring. Whoever is caught before getting inside the ring must remain in the "Cook" and do the part of the first child.
    In Hide-and-Seek one will cover his eyes and the others will hide. Whoever is got first must cover his or her eyes.
